Job Description

Reporting to the Regional Manager and leading a like-minded team of coaching staff, you’ll be responsible for the delivery of a high-quality, school-holiday, Kings Camps experience, ensuring children aged 5 to 17 are safe, active, having fun and learning together. Before the season begins, Camp Managers undertake administration and preparation responsibilities, communication with your team, planning timetables and ensuring your venue is ready. During season, Camp Managers are onsite from 8am to 5:30pm as the first-point of contact for staff, children, parents, venue and our central office team. Camp Managers are the designated safeguarding lead at a venue, dealing with concerns in a timely manner, completing paperwork and risk assessments, responding to feedback, recording incidents and managing OFSTED requirements.

Child safety is our number one priority so you’ll ensure that the welfare of children is paramount at all times, supervising children during breaks, participating in swimming sessions, overseeing the safe use of equipment, promptly recording any incidents. Implementing behaviour management policies, and upholding health and safety standards and procedures.

About us

Kings Camps are a market leading not-for-profit organisation offering sports and activity day camps at over 50 UK locations, getting children and young people active, having fun and learning together. Founded in 1991, we were inspired by US-style summer camps. We decided that youngsters in the UK would love to experience school holiday camps too, and established a model which meant we could reach even more children through not-for-profit work in the UK and overseas. Our coaches (we call them Red Tops) deliver high quality sports camps with an energy, passion and commitment to child development that we call the Kings Factor®.
